History: something is wrong …[edit]

"Grupo Modelo, founded in 1925…" "Corona … was first brewed in 1925 by Cervecería Modelo on the tenth anniversary of the brewery." One of these facts must be wrong. (I suspect the second one.) Zythophile (talk) 00:39, 9 June 2023 (UTC)[reply]

The text from the AB website reads:

Corona Extra was first brewed in 1925 at the Cervecería Modelo in Mexico City, Mexico. Ten years after its launch, Corona became the best-selling beer in Mexico.

I suspect this has been misinterpreted at some stage as:

Corona Extra was first brewed in 1925 at the Cervecería Modelo in Mexico City, Mexico, ten years after its launch. Corona became the best-selling beer in Mexico [some unspecified time later].

The current article text does not match the website. Tevildo (talk) 23:28, 17 August 2023 (UTC)[reply]
